Abstract:

Pólya's first publication, his 1913 Dissertation [1] in Hungarian, treats a problem in probability. His lifelong interest in this field is evident from his Bibliography (see Collected Papers, Vol.4; numbers in [ ] below are those given there). Besides the twenty papers reprinted in that volume, some ten more titles indicate probability and statistics. Some of his contributions to probability are classified as analysis, others perhaps as combinatorics. The major items which will be discussed here have long since become textbook material, [R1].
